Engine Mounts, Bushings & Strut Mounts Manufacturer | Ecozx LOGO
sales@sailingautoparts.com
008618892616103

click image to zoom in

OEM NO:
C2P7942
CATEGORIES:
CAR BRAND:
JAGUAR

XF
2008 - 2015
XK
1950 - 2014